Lockup gets the home sealed and weatherproof. Fixing is the stage that decides whether the finish looks sharp or rough. We take both seriously because painters, tilers and plasterers all inherit what we leave behind.

What good fixing looks like

  • Square jambs and doors that close cleanly
  • Skirting with tight scribes and minimal joins
  • Architraves with even reveals all around
  • No proud nails, no torn timber, no rushed cuts
How we deliver

A clear process from first call to handover

  1. 01

    Lockup

    Doors and windows in, building sealed, ready for plasterer and other internal trades.

  2. 02

    Fixing

    Once plastering is complete - doors hung, skirting and architraves fixed, trims tidied.

  3. 03

    Pre-paint check

    We walk the home with the painter so any prep issues are sorted before paint goes on.
